Suitable for anyone wanting to understand User Acceptance Testing.Technology Testing Series - TM 020The User Acceptance Test Planning Guide is a document that will provide you with a framework for defining the effort and capability for User Acceptance Test Planning. The reason for a User Acceptance Test Plan is that, whenever resources such as money or effort are to be expended, this should be done in the support of a specific business requirement or initiative. A credible User Acceptance Test Plan sufficiently captures both the quantifiable and unquantifiable components of UAT for a proposed Project/Program.The document is structured in a tutorial Q&A style. It poses questions for you to think about and answer in assistance to completing your UAT plan. It will cover influencing factors across the SDLC, with a focus from this on UAT.
